What Are the Possible Defenses Offered for My Charges?



When encountering criminal fees, an accused may ask yourself which defenses can be appropriate to their situation. Recognizing the variety of prospective defenses is crucial for a complete legal approach. Usual defenses consist of alibi, where the defendant confirms they were elsewhere throughout the crime; self-defense, which warrants the use of pressure to protect oneself; and absence of intent, where the accused demonstrates they did not have the requisite psychological state to dedicate the crime. Various other defenses may consist of entrapment, saying that police generated criminal behavior, or insanity, declaring the offender was not in an audio state of mind. In addition, breaking legal rights during arrest or investigation can likewise work as a protection. By reviewing these alternatives with a criminal defense attorney, a defendant can examine which defenses might be feasible based on the specifics of their situation and the evidence available.


How Do You Manage Appeal Deals and Settlements?



Just how does a criminal protection legal representative method appeal deals and negotiations? An experienced lawyer generally evaluates the strengths and weak points of the instance, taking into consideration the evidence, possible defenses, and the client's rate of interests. They involve in open conversations with the prosecution to determine the probability of positive outcomes through plea contracts. This entails working out terms that could bring about minimized costs or lesser sentences.The legal representative additionally connects the potential dangers of mosting likely to trial, consisting of the chance of harsher fines if convicted. By giving a clear understanding of the legal landscape, they encourage customers to make enlightened decisions concerning whether to accept an appeal deal or proceed to test. Reliable settlement skills are crucial, as they can significantly influence the terms and conditions of any plea arrangement. Ultimately, the lawyer's objective is to protect the ideal possible outcome for their client while steering via the complexities of the legal system.


What Are Your Costs and Payment Structure?



What should clients anticipate regarding costs and payment frameworks from their criminal defense attorney? Comprehending the monetary facets of legal representation is crucial. Attorneys commonly supply various charge setups, including hourly prices, flat fees i loved this for specific solutions, or backup fees, though the latter is less usual in criminal cases. Customers must ask about the overall approximated expenses, including potential added costs like court costs or expert witness charges.Transparency is crucial; clients should understand what is included in the charge and whether a retainer is needed upfront. It is also crucial to review layaway plan if the complete cost is expensive. Some legal representatives may supply adaptable options to accommodate clients' monetary scenarios. Customers need to really feel equipped to ask comprehensive concerns about any type of uncertain fees or payment terms, guaranteeing they have a clear understanding of their financial responsibilities before continuing with depiction.
